February 2006 in “American journal of physiology. Cell physiology” This study observed that in hormone-starved prostate cancer cells, the androgen 5alpha-dihydrotestosterone rapidly induces matriptase activation and shedding, which involves androgen receptor signaling and requires both transcription and protein synthesis.
